Centralize AI Control or Let Teams Experiment? Binary Business - BB-05
When AI enters your organization, you've got to decide who controls it. Do you centralize it under one team with clear governance and standards? Or do you let individual teams experiment, learn, and build what they need?
In this episode, I break down when to centralize AI versus when to let teams experiment, using the ABCD framework.
One approach creates consistency. The other creates innovation. Most companies either centralize too early and kill innovation, or stay decentralized too long and create chaos.
